More than 200 victim impact statements have been submitted to a Manhattan federal court ahead of the sentencing of Alex Mashinsky, founder of the collapsed crypto lender Celsius Network. The documents, spanning over 400 pages, detail the financial and emotional toll on customers who trusted the platform’s now-debunked safety claims.

Mashinsky, who admitted to fraud, is seeking leniency ahead of his May 8 sentencing. Meanwhile, the Department of Justice is considering new rules to prevent unfair payouts in crypto bankruptcies, as clawback lawsuits compound the misery for Celsius victims.
